Wet Memorial Day ahead

The National Weather Service predicts a mild but rainy Memorial Day with temperatures in the lower 60s and light rain most of the day. As much as a quarter inch of rain is possible tomorrow. The rain will taper off overnight to Tuesday, which will be mostly cloudy with a 40 percent chance of showers. Expect daily showers through Saturday and daytime temperatures in 50s and lower 60s. Nighttime lows will be in the mid-40s.
